Before the incident
I was working in the hood with a pbmc sample no splash but i felt a droplet in one my eyes.
What happened
I vortex one of my samples in a conical bottle and I opened it and place the cap down. that was when i felt the droplet in my eye.
Injury or illness
left Eye splash
Object or substance involved
blood sample
Summary line
While processing blood samples EE opened a conical bottle and placed the camp down when they felt a droplet of fluid in their left eye.
